Aleksandrs Ņiživijs
Latvian ice hockey player / From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ia
Aleksandrs Ņiživijs (born September 16, 1976) is a former Latvian professional ice hockey player. His last club was Dinamo Riga of the Kontinental Hockey League (KHL).[1] He was also a regular Latvia national ice hockey team player.[2]
